Such is the case with the “First Annual PlayStation Network PLAY” initiative announced by SCEA today. It’s a bit confusing for simpler folk like us, but we’ve parsed the details of this deal so you don’t have to.

Starting Aug. 9, gamers can pre-order select games. Each pre-order comes with theme for the PS3. And each game, when purchased, comes with an additional gift. Even better: PlayStation Plus members (anyone? anyone?) will receive an automatic 20% off any game that’s part of the PLAY lineup.

Finally, the goodest part: Buy all four games by Sept. 19 and you’ll get a voucher code for Payday: The Heist, a game we called “the next big thing for Left 4 Dead fans” in a recentpreview.

Here’s a quick look at the four games in this initiative:

Street Fighter III Third Strike Online Edition (Aug. 23). Gift: Unlock Gill immediately without having to beat the game with every character.

The Baconing (Aug. 30). Gift: Additional co-op character, Roesha – One Bad Mutha.

BloodRayne: Betrayal (Sept. 6). Gift: Exclusive dynamic theme and virtual item for Home avatar. (And with the 360 version delayed till Oct. 5, this is also a rare third-party PSN timed exclusive!)

Renegade Ops (Sept. 13). Gift: Vehicle & Character Pack including two new vehicles and special weapons.
